Vertical blinds are a popular choice for sliding glass doors due to their ability to be easily adjusted to control light and privacy levels. Unlike traditional horizontal blinds that may get in the way of opening and closing sliding doors, vertical blinds are designed to stack neatly to the side, providing unobstructed access to the door while still offering functionality. They are also a great option for larger windows and can be customized to fit any size of sliding glass door.

One of the key advantages of vertical blinds is their versatility in light control. With the ability to tilt the slats to allow as much or as little light as desired, vertical blinds offer a tailored solution for adjusting the ambiance of a room. Whether you want to let in natural light during the day or block out harsh sunlight to reduce glare, vertical blinds give you the flexibility to create the perfect lighting environment in your home.

Privacy is another important factor to consider when choosing window treatments for sliding glass doors. Vertical blinds provide an effective way to maintain privacy without compromising on style. By simply adjusting the angle of the slats, you can easily block the view from outside while still allowing some light to filter through. This is particularly beneficial for homes with close neighbors or high foot traffic outside.

When choosing vertical blinds for sliding glass doors, it is important to consider the durability and ease of maintenance of the materials. For high-traffic areas such as sliding glass doors, it is recommended to opt for materials that are easy to clean and maintain. Vinyl and aluminum blinds are popular choices for sliding glass doors due to their resistance to moisture and easy wipe-clean surfaces. Fabric vertical blinds offer a softer and more textured look but may require more frequent cleaning to maintain their appearance.

Installing vertical blinds for sliding glass doors is a relatively straightforward process that can be done by homeowners with basic DIY skills. Most vertical blinds come with mounting hardware and instructions for easy installation. However, for larger or more complex configurations, it may be advisable to seek professional help to ensure a proper fit and secure installation.
